1 Yuan, The Provincial Bank of Kiangsu, Kiangsu, China, 1927

Description (Brief):

One (1) yuan note, specimen

Obverse Image: Green background with denomination and bank name written in green, serial number in red on green background.

Reverse Image: English and Chinese text in green on green background with geometric designs.

Description (Brief)

Reverse Text: THE PROVINCIAL BANK OF KIANGSU / PROMISES TO PAY THE BEARER ON DEMAND AT ITS OFFICE HERE / ONE / YUAN / LOCAL CURRENCY / PRESIDENT / MAY 1st 1927 / mANAGER / BUREAU OF ENGRAVING AND PRINTING PEKING CHINA

Date Made: 1927

Location: Currently not on view

Place Made: China: Kiangsu
